Names and Functions of Parts

Rear Panel

a

(network) connector (RJ-45 modular jack)

This is a 10BASE-T/100BASE-TX connector for network
(Ethernet) connection.

When using a LAN cable: For safety, do not connect the
unit to a connector for peripheral device wiring that might
have excessive voltage.

b AUDIO IN L/R connectors (pin jacks)
These input analog audio signals.

c VIDEO IN connector (pin jack)
This inputs the analog composite video signal.

d AUDIO OUT L/R connectors (pin jacks)
These output the playback audio as an analog signal. For a
stereo signal, connector L outputs the left channel, and
connector R outputs the right channel

e VIDEO OUT connector (pin jack)
This outputs the playback video as a composite signal.

f Reset button
Used to forcibly restart this unit when it hangs or freezes.
Push this button using a sharply pointed tools, such as a
pencil or stretched paper clip.

g Dip switches
Used for various services. Set all switches to OFF.
